JAWS VS THE DOGS
THE FINS AND FANGS CUP
Saturday 5th September, 2020.
Marks the date of the inaugural Fins & Fangs Cup between one of Jakarta’s oldest and well established Golf Societies: The DOGS (Djakarta Old Golf Society) and Jakarta’s most recently formed Golf society: JAWS (Jakarta, Albatross, Weekday Society).
The DOGS kindly accepted the proposal to duel in the good spirit of Golf and camaraderie for golfing bragging rights amongst the Jakarta Golf community.

The format of play was Fourball Better Ball, Nett based match play with 12 teams of 2 vs 2, so 24 players per team and the day saw a wide range of golfers with varying skill levels, teaming up among their golfing teammates, in the most exciting and purest form of golfing competition: ‘Matchplay’.

The DOGS fielded a team of players ranging from handicap 3 – 30 and JAWS fielded a team of players with handicaps from 4 – 28, and it was up to the prudent and shrewd decision making of each Captains Douglas McQuarter(DOGS) and Tarlok Singh (JAWS) to select their most competitive 2 ball combinations to fly the flag of their representing Golf Societies.

The venue was Permata Sentul, the canny Thomson and Wolveridge Golfing layout known for its quirky playing conditions, highlighted by very small and slippery greens, narrow fairways and dramatically undulating fairways, the base for the current 6 week DOGS golfing eclectic event with the Fins and Fangs matchplay falling on Week 3 of their Week 6 cycle.

The DOGS committee kindly allowed JAWS players to not only play their match-play games but also register and compete in the regular DOGS fun format of play with prizes like Longest Drive, Nearest to the Pin, Drive and Pitch etc…

With a few JAWS players plundering the DOGs treasury like Vice-Captain Simon Reynolds who took home the Drive and Chip award on the Par 4, Hole 4 sticking his second shot from the fairway from 110m to 8 feet with a pitching wedge.

It was clear from the start both Golfing Societies were up for reveling in the challenge to take on this tricky mountain course layout and the match tee’d off under very hot and humid conditions just after noon.

After the turn the clouds overhead threatened with an inevitable afternoon rainfall, and with most teams having played out between 12-14 holes, play was suspended as players took shelter out on course.

Adding to the intrigue and excitement of the golfing on course, after about a 30 minute break, and relative relief from rain, thunder and lightning play resumed under atmospheric and misty afternoon fog, following the heavy rain.

In the end, as the rain returned and with the light fading quickly, and with several teams yet to finish 18 holes, the Captains agreed to compromise for the sake of a deciding on the day result, the ongoing games yet to be concluded with holes remaining, were to be decided and concluded based on the final score at the end of play, albeit with holes remaining.

In conclusion it was JAWS who were crowned as champions by a slim margin of 1 match, with 5 wins, 4 losses and 3 draws of the inaugural Fins and Fangs Cups 2020 Inter-society match play, a glowing tribute to both teams fighting spirit and the well balanced team selection and player combinations by both teams captains and committee members in the run up to the event.

As a bonus, two things happened , JAWS and DOGS celebrated the birthday of JAWS cofounder and admin Chris and (over 8 million IDR) good money was raised for The DOS chosen charity: Yayasan HOGS thanks to the generous on the day support from both societies, and a great day out of golf combining good competitive golf, in warm spirits, played on a great course whilst supporting a charity doing great things helping Indonesian kids suffering from Cleft lip and palate disabilities. With the confidence that money raised will be helping to provide major facial reconstructive surgery for these kids in major need of life-changing support.
